Output 17dd9745a210e173e2847624f7359540b4bff67394beedd16e292bc277ffb195:129

value
859093
script pubkey
OP_0 OP_PUSHBYTES_32 eea24dea1997b45cb2237e79054d3e66b12f37cb80a7f20fa3c1bddd4f8958fc
address
bc1qa63ym6sej769ev3r0eus2nf7v6cj7d7tsznlyrarcx7a6nuftr7qfthgyl
transaction
17dd9745a210e173e2847624f7359540b4bff67394beedd16e292bc277ffb195
spent
true